#e5502e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e5502e is composed of 89.8% red, 31.4% green and 18%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 65.1% magenta, 79.9%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 11.1 degrees, a saturation of 77.9% and a lightness of 53.9%. #e5502e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a05c with #cb0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

● #e5502e color description : Bright red.
#e5502e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e5502e has RGB values of R:229, G:80, B:46 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.65, Y:0.8,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15028270.

Shades and Tints of #e5502e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#fdf1ee is the lightest one.

Tones of #e5502e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8b8988 is the less saturated color, while #f7451c is the most saturated one.
